
Research Analyst
We are looking for an experienced and knowledgeable Research Analyst to join the University of California, Irvine! As a Research Analyst, you will be responsible for designing, coordinating, and executing research initiatives with the goal of improving the university’s overall research performance. Our ideal candidate would possess a strong knowledge of research methods, statistical analysis and data visualization techniques, and have a passion for uncovering and presenting meaningful insights. To be successful as a Research Analyst at UCI, you must have a Bachelor's degree in a related field, such as Statistics, Mathematics, or Economics. You should also have a minimum of two years of experience in research or data analytics and a strong understanding of databases and data processing. Proficiency with statistical software and Microsoft Excel is a must. Additionally, strong interpersonal and communication skills are essential, as you will be interacting with a variety of stakeholders, including faculty and staff. If you have a passion for research and a commitment to improving the educational environment at UCI, we would love to hear from you!

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Research Analyst in Irvine, CA, USA is $42,000 - $80,000. The average salary is between $61,000 and $71,000. This range may vary depending on the qualifications of the individual, the amount of experience they have in the field, and the specific company they are employed by.
